What is CDHS mission?

The CDHS Mission: To design and deliver quality human services that improve the safety and independence of the people of Colorado. Who We Are: CDHS is the second largest agency in Colorado State Government, with a $1.8 billion budget for state fiscal year 2004.

What is the Division of Facilities Management?

Division of Facilities Management: The Division of Facilities Management is a customer-driven support organization responsible for providing facilities management services to all CDHS agencies and offices, within available resources.

How many mental health hospitals are there in Colorado?

CDHS operates two mental health institutes, or state-run psychiatric hospitals. The Colorado Mental Health Institute at Fort Logan is a 94-bed hospital in Denver that provides inpatient behavioral health treatment services to adult patients. The Colorado Mental Health Institute at Pueblo is a 494-bed hospital in southern Colorado that provides inpatient behavioral health services for adults, adolescents and geriatric patients. Both offer career opportunities in many multi-disciplinary professions, including nursing, psychology, social work and medicine.

What is Colorado State Employee Assistance Program?

Colorado State Employee Assistance Program - A professional assessment, referral, and short-term counseling service offered to State employees with work-related or personal concerns.
